Possible Causes of Basement Flooding
Basement flooding in Hermosa Beach can occur due to a variety of reasons, often linked to heavy rainfall, storm surges, or plumbing failures. When intense storms pass through, excess water can overwhelm drainage systems, causing water to seep into basements through cracks or flooding vents. Additionally, poorly maintained gutters and downspouts can contribute to water pooling around your foundation, increasing the risk of seepage into your basement.
Another common cause is plumbing issues, such as burst pipes or malfunctioning sump pumps. Aging or damaged plumbing fixtures can quickly lead to significant water accumulation inside your basement. Foundation cracks or porous concrete can also allow groundwater to enter your space, especially during high tide or sudden downpours. Recognizing these causes early can help prevent extensive flood damage and costly repairs.
How Our Experts Fix Basement Flooding
Our team begins by quickly assessing the extent of water intrusion and identifying the source of the flooding. We employ advanced moisture detection tools to locate hidden dampness and ensure no area is overlooked. Properly identifying the cause allows us to implement targeted solutions that prevent future issues, such as sealing foundation cracks or upgrading drainage systems.
Once the source is under control, we proceed with removing all standing water using industrial-grade pumps and wet vacuums. Our team then thoroughly dries and dehumidifies the affected areas to prevent mold growth and structural damage. We use comm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ers to ensure the space is completely dry, restoring a safe and healthy environment.
After drying, our experts clean and sanitize all surfaces to eliminate bacteria, viruses, and potential mold spores. We also inspect existing plumbing and foundation elements to recommend necessary repairs or upgrades, safeguarding your home from future flooding. Is mold growth a concern after flooding?
Yes, mold can develop rapidly in damp environments. That’s why thorough drying, cleaning, and disinfection are crucial immediately after water removal to prevent mold proliferation and protect your health.
